  Title: Namib Desert, Namibia, Africa
  Description:
  One of the driest regions on Earth, the Namib Desert, Namibia, Africa        
  (23.0N, 15.0E) lies adjacent to the Atlantic coast but upwelling oceanic 
  water causes a very stable rainless atmosphere.  The few local inland
  rivers  do not reach the sea but instead appear as long indentations where
  rivers  penetrate the dune fields and end as small dry lakes.  The vast
  dune fields    are the result of sands deposited over millions of years by
  the stream flow.
